Welcome to SeaDream... As well as excursions off the boat, make sure you enjoy time on the yacht for at least part of a day. Relaxing on a Bali Bed at the Top of the Yacht is also part of what makes SeaDream such a different experience.

 

Lots of regulars hardly ever leave the Yacht!

 

If you haven't been to St Barths before, rent a car (arrange ahead of time) and drive around the island. Stop for lunch somewhere great, and go to Grand Saline beach. It is very easy to do. If you prefer to shop, spend the day in Gustavia and St Jean instead.
